Loadshedding Suspended Early On Sunday Morning

Loadshedding was suspended early on Sunday morning after more than a day of power cuts, reports Cape town Etc .

This follows the announcement by Power utility Eskom that stage three load shedding will begin on Friday at 5 pm and continue through the weekend.

This was expected to continue until Sunday night but was suspended early.

In a short statement on Sunday, Eskom announced that load shedding was stopped at 6 am after the sufficient replenishment of emergency reserves.

For the past week, Eskoms power output has been squeezed after the unexpected breakdown of six units at Matimba and Lethabo, News24 reports.
